if you mean the live ingame GPS map then I dont think there is a way. 

 

However if you wanted to do traditional real navigation you have plenty of options available to you. Such as having the image file of the map opned, a web browser interactive map, there is also a phone app for that purpose if you didnt have a second screen. Hi all .Sorry, I recently reinstalled my second monitor, where I plan to use il2missionplanner. Of course I set the "extended monitor" function from the control panel of my Nvidia video card. Unfortunately I noticed, however, that in game, the mouse pointer does not go to the second monitor, the one with the map open, not allowing me to use it. I am forced to use the "Alt-Tab" key combination but I don't think it's the optimal solution. How do you do it? Thanks

maybe i solved ...

 

Posted

In your startup.cfg file, located in the data folder, go to the [KEY = input] section and set exclusive to 0.

 

[KEY = input]
    exclusive = 0
    input_map = "input.map"
    mouse_plane_control = 0
    old_trackir = 0
    turrets_dc = 0
